What Does It Take to Detect an AI Agent? Minimal Feature Sets for Behavioral Detection under Browser Automation

Bot detectors deployed at scale treat traffic as binary: human or bot. This assumption breaks when AI agents browse the web through browser automation, a traffic class that is neither and that binary classifiers structurally cannot represent. We present a three-class detection framework distinguishing humans, bots, and AI agents, and show that the binary-vs-agent confusion is architectural: a binary human-vs-bot detector misroutes agent sessions because its label space lacks an agent class. Rogue OpenAI agent that hacked startup tried to attack other firms

ChatGPT developer says activity by autonomous tool was not at severity or scale of what occurred at Hugging Face OpenAI has revealed that a cyber-attack carried out by a rogue AI agent had more than one victim. The ChatGPT developer said the agent – an autonomous tool able to carry out sequences of commands without human help – had located and used logins to access four other unnamed “publicly-available services” in addition to the US startup Hugging Face. US foreign robot ban to benefit Tesla, other American developers, analysts say

China’s robotics firms have run into a fresh obstacle in their global expansion, after the United States banned imports of new foreign-made models, which analysts say could benefit Tesla and other American developers. The Federal Communications Commission (FCC) added foreign-produced “advanced robotic devices” to its Covered List on Tuesday, blocking new models from obtaining the authorisation required to be imported and sold in the US.
